  2. st johns is a very heavy pressured water the fish have seen nearly all the tricks, but i would try 2 grains of boyant fake corn popped up and spod/catty some real corn over it, little and often, the water is gin clear and the bottom is very rough from the gravel, i made the mistake of fishing far side of a big gravel bar, that cost me a BIG fish as the gravel bar wore through my mainline (sensor at time) if when you get there have a good look at manor farm as less people fish on manor and its closer to the bogs/shower car park good luck, i was plagued by bad luck on there
